Ombudsman
An Ombudsman is an advocate for residents of nursing homes, board and care homes, and assisted living. Ombudsmen provide information about how to find a facility and what to do to get quality care. They are trained to resolve problems. If you want, the ombudsman can assist you with complaints. However, unless you give the ombudsman permission to share your concerns, these matters are kept confidential.
The State Office for the Aging (SOFA) employs an ombudsman in each county of New York State. The State Office for the Aging can be reached at 1-800-342-9871.
